JEMBRANA - The Gilimanuk Police Team, Jembrana, Bali, thwarted the perpetrators of motorcycle theft (curanmor) who wanted to smuggle a stolen Honda CBR motorbike out of Bali.

Gilimanuk Police Chief Kompol I Gusti Putu Darmanatha said the perpetrator had the initials MR (27) from Lumajang, East Java. The arrest of the perpetrator started from information received by the South Denpasar Police regarding the theft case.

"For that, at that time I ordered all members in charge of conducting strict inspections at the Gilimanuk Port crossing," said Kompol Darmanatha, Tuesday, November 16.

From the interrogation, the perpetrator admitted that the Honda CBR motorbike without the plate was obtained from the theft at the boarding house on Jalan Danau Tempe I, Telaga Sari Gang, Sanur Kauh Village, South Denpasar, Denpasar City.

"The perpetrator stole the motorbike using the original ignition key which he found about one month ago at the victim's office and it is true that the victim lost his motorbike ignition key about one month ago," added Kompol Darmanatha.

This Honda CBR motorbike will be brought to Lumajang according to the location of the address where the perpetrator lives who is deposited in the pickup. The stolen motorbike is planned to be sold again by the perpetrators.

"The perpetrator is subject to Article 363 of the Criminal Code with a maximum penalty of 5 years. For the material loss suffered by the victim of Rp 12 million and while the people and evidence we have secured at the Gilimanuk Police. Furthermore, we will hand it over to the South Denpasar Police for further investigation," he said.
